
Ein Bildfehler kann frustrierend sein, insbesondere in einer visuellen Medienlandschaft. Um dieses Problem zu beheben, können Entwickler spezielle Funktionen implementieren. Eine solche Funktion zur Fehlerbehandlung wird in folgendem Beispiel beschrieben. Sie sorgt dafür, dass im Falle eines Ladefehlers für ein Bild ein alternatives Bild angezeigt wird.
Die Funktion zur Bildfehlerbehebung
Die Funktion imageLoadError
erhält ein Bild-Element als Parameter und versucht, das Bild zu laden. Wenn ein Fehler auftritt, wird anstelle des fehlgeschlagenen Bildes ein Fallback-Bild verwendet.
So funktioniert die Funktion
Die Funktion beginnt mit dem Entfernen des OnError-Attributs des Bildes, um zu verhindern, dass die Fehlerbehandlungsroutine erneut ausgelöst wird. Dann wird das Fallback-Bild, das im Code definiert ist, in die src
-Eigenschaft des Bildes eingefügt. Anschließend wird überprüft, ob es vorherige SOURCE
-Elemente gibt, die ebenfalls geupdated werden müssen. Wenn diese vorhanden sind, wird ihr srcset
-Attribut ebenfalls auf das Fallback-Bild gesetzt.
Live-Updates und Informationen
Diese Funktion kann in Webanwendungen implementiert werden, um eine konsistente Benutzererfahrung zu gewährleisten. Live-Updates können zusätzlich implementiert werden, um Informationen in Echtzeit anzuzeigen, was für eine dynamische Interaktion sorgt. Das Bild bleibt in diesem Kontext stets relevant und ansprechend.
Die Nutzung solcher Techniken verbessert die Benutzerfreundlichkeit und sorgt dafür, dass die Inhalte immer ansprechend sind, auch wenn technische Probleme auftreten. Zum Beispiel könnte man sich auf Quellen wie Chip Somodevilla verlassen, um qualitativ hochwertige Bilder in den Medien zu integrieren.
Details zur Meldung